**CI note: timezone weirdness in report exports**

Heads up, support folks — if a customer says their Ledgerpine export shows times shifted by a few hours, it's probably the CI image. The export workers got rebuilt last week and the base image defaults to UTC, while older workers used the account's locale. Fix is rolling out; meanwhile tell customers the data itself is fine, just the display offset. Affected exports carry the build token shown below.

build token for bajof-tahop: htk4_a981

## Authentication

All requests to the Gridlock crossword generator API require a key in the X-Gridlock-Key header. Plugin authors get scoped keys: generate, validate, and export. Rate limit is 60 requests per minute per key. Requests without a valid key return 401. Grid sizes above 25x25 require the export scope. For sandbox testing against the internal staging endpoint, use the key below.

app token of kafop-hahaf = kto11_iRLdsMBafGn

## FY Budget Request — Orchard Wing Expansion (Managers Only)

Department heads should review the proposed allocation for the Orchard Wing expansion before Thursday's planning session. The request covers staffing uplift, equipment refresh for the Calverton site, and a contingency reserve of eight percent. Marta Kellwin has flagged that phasing the spend across two quarters reduces exposure. Please log objections in the tracker. The strategic rationale behind this request is summarised below.

board note of kageg-bahof: The renewal with Holwynax Holdings closes at $2 million a year, 5 percent below the last contract. Project Ulaath slips by two quarters because of the supplier delay.

# Runbook: Hunting leaked file descriptors in Quillgate

When the `fd_open` gauge climbs steadily between deploys, suspect a leak rather than load. First confirm on a single pod: exec in and count entries under `/proc/1/fd`, noting how many are sockets in CLOSE_WAIT versus regular files. Capture two snapshots ten minutes apart before restarting anything — we need the delta for the postmortem. Reproduce locally with the Marbury load harness, which requires the service running with the following configuration values.

settings of yagep-bajog:
[istdor]
port = 4000
region = south-2
host = istdor.qorvelcorp.internal
timeout_ms = 5000
retries = 5